Key Responsibilities:
- Understands the job requirements, meets the job time estimate, ensures that the job is done properly
- Understands what constitutes an excellent job and able to spot and correct deficiencies
- Planning the day's work and using resources efficiently
- Motivate staff, and report on positive and negative staff performance
- Mentoring, instructing and training junior, intermediate staff
- Ensuring crew safety, by adhering to all safety requirements
- Proper, professional and timely communication with clients
Required Education / Experience:
- Minimum of three years in the landscaping industry
- Minimum of one year in a supervisory role of landscaping maintenance crews
- Thorough knowledge of Southern Ontario plant, shrub and tree varieties and standard horticultural practices (i.e. planting, pruning, fertilizing and when to do so)
- Comprehensive knowledge of landscaping tools, materials and techniques
- Excellent written and communication skills, capable to document work issues and problems
- Physically able to perform all tasks required
- Complete knowledge of PPE, safety requirements
- Must have a valid G driver’s license and a clean drivers abstract
Working Conditions:
- Love of working outdoors is essential
- Willingness to work in bad weather conditions i.e. rain, high humidity and heat and cold weather
Full-time employment including winter work available, benefits available after 3 months.
